> > of day counters. Is it possible, in the framework of QuantLibAddin, to use
> > these
> > as functions without having to export the Calendar/Day counter constructor?
> > If so, how do you do that?
>
>In a metadata file having headerOnly='true' you define your functions
>with class Procedure. Then somewhere under qla you implement a
>wrapper for the QuantLib function. For examples of this please see
>srcgen/utilities.xml
>qla/utilites.cpp
